Cathy Brackemyer came to work at the Senior Resource Center after working 13 years before retiring in banking. She performed all the roles from teller to Vice
President.
Cathy has many
responsibilities for
both the Freeport
and Hanover offices.
She helps the
Community Care
staff with the billing
for the visits they
do in the
community. She
also bills for the
screens that are done for the nursing homes, working with them in the screening process and getting the paperwork that they need. She does all these things while meeting the requirements and criteria for the State of Illinois.
As an IT (Information and Technology) leader she is the one who keeps our computers, telephones, fax and copy machines all serviced and working. She also orders the supplies that are used by all the staff.
So when we think about the eight pillars of service representing the services provided by the Senior Resource Center, Cathy is one of the people making
up the support base of all of the pillars.
When Cathy is not at the Senior Resource Center she is happy to be with her family. She has been
married for 33 years to Brian. During Brian’s 26 years in the military they moved 19 times before
settling down in their current cozy home at Lake Carroll. One of their sons is a mechanical
engineer and the other one a chemistry teacher. They are now enjoying their
beautiful granddaughters, Stella who is 2 1/2 and Lucy who is 1 month old.
You may see Cathy and Brian on the road enjoying their Harley, off the road in
their UTV or out on the golf course.
Cathy is inspired by helping others and says that is the most fulfilling part
of her job. We thank you, Cathy, for helping us get our work completed
Cathy, Brian, Lucy & Stella
so WE can help others!
